What Is Dysport?

Dysport is an FDA-approved botulinum toxin type A that works by temporarily blocking nerve signals to facial muscles. Like Botox, Dysport inhibits the release of acetylcholine at neuromuscular junctions, preventing muscle contractions that create forehead wrinkles.

Originally developed in Europe, Dysport has been safely used worldwide for over two decades. It received FDA approval in the United States in 2009 and has since become a popular choice for patients seeking wrinkle reduction with natural-looking results.

How Dysport Differs from Botox

While both Dysport and Botox are effective neurotoxins, they have distinct characteristics:

  • Onset of action: Dysport may show results 1-2 days earlier than Botox
  • Spread pattern: Dysport spreads slightly more, making it ideal for larger treatment areas
  • Unit dosing: Dysport uses different unit measurements than Botox
  • Duration: Results typically last 3-4 months, similar to Botox
  • Natural appearance: Some patients prefer Dysport’s softer, more natural look

Results Timeline and Expectations

Dysport results follow a predictable progression:

  • 24-48 hours: Initial muscle relaxation begins
  • 3-5 days: Noticeable wrinkle softening
  • 7-10 days: Optimal results achieved
  • 3-4 months: Gradual return of muscle function

Many patients appreciate Dysport’s faster onset compared to other neurotoxins, allowing them to see results sooner after treatment.

Safety Profile and Side Effects

Dysport has an excellent safety record when administered by qualified practitioners. Potential side effects are typically mild and temporary:

  • Mild swelling or redness at injection sites
  • Temporary bruising
  • Rare: temporary eyelid drooping
  • Headache (uncommon)

Cost Considerations

Dysport pricing is based on units used, with forehead treatments typically requiring 50-60 units. While Dysport uses more units than Botox, the cost per treatment area is often comparable. Dr. Egan provides detailed pricing information during your consultation.
